If they're worthless then, why play at all? If they are scarce, convey any kind of status on the platform or unlock anything at all, then i assure you there will be someone gaming the system.

Poker requires gambling something with at least symbolic value, or else people don't care about winning or losing hands and just go all in recklessly all the time.

I heard online poker is dead and AI killed it.

A friend of mine was an avid online poker player. He says the AI systems beat humans all the time, and that the platforms countered with AI AI detection systems which allow for a maximum tolerance of winning hands that is considered human level. As a response, players using AI systems added deliberate error rates to hide from the detection.

Game's basically broken. Sorry.
